  • holding, after a hearing, that a deed transfer and leaseback transaction intended to establish a security interest
  • “The settlement agreement before us contained no express provision that time was of the essence, but the precise phraseology is not controlling. Parties to a contract may make timely performance material even though there is no express provision to that effect.”
